Optional EIB (ACU+ Controller Extended Interface Board)
The optional EIB (ACU+ Controller Extended Interface Board) provides additional
connection points for voltage and current inputs, programmable relay outputs, and
temperature probes. Refer to Figure 4-7.
Procedure
Voltage Inputs, Current Inputs, and Programmable Relay Outputs: Voltage input,
current input, and relay output leads are connected to screw-type terminal blocks located
on the optional EIB (ACU+ Controller Extended Interface Board) mounted inside the
distribution cabinet. Recommended torque for these connections is 5 in-lbs.
a) Current Inputs: Connect up to three (3) shunt inputs to the EIB (Extended
Interface Board). Observe proper polarity. Refer to Table 4-2 to determine what
shunt input to connect to on the EIB board. Refer to the ACU+ User Instructions
(UM1M820BNA) and program the shunt input parameters found in the EIB menu.
